Book excerpt: Introduction: Conjugated linoleic acid (CLA) is a food supplement that is proposed as an anti-obesity supplement in animal and human studies. Animal studies have shown a significant anti-obesity effect of CLA, but results in humans were inconsistent, where some of the studies found an anti-obesity effect while other studies failed to find any decline in obesity markers after CLA supplementation. This meta-analysis aimed to determine if oral CLA supplementation has been shown to reduce obesity-related markers in women.Method: Pub Med, Cochrane Library, and Google Scholar were used to identify the eligible trials using two main searching strategies: the first one was to search eligible trials using keywords u201cConjugated linoleic acidu201d, u201cCLAu201d, u201cWomenu201d, and the second strategy was to extract the eligible trials from previously published systematic reviews and meta-analyses. The eligible trials were placebo control trials where women supplemented with CLA mixture in the form of oral capsules for 6 months or less. Furthermore, eligible trials reported body weight (BW), body mass index (BMI), total body fat (TBF), percentage body fat (BF%), and/ or lean body mass (LBM).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: CLA is classified as an omega-6 fatty acid, which is a specific category of fatty acid. Naturally present in ruminant animal flesh and dairy products (e.g., sheep, goats, and cows) is this substance. Contrary to the majority of unsaturated fatty acids, CLA possesses a conjugated double bond system in which the double bonds are not separated by a single bond. Several studies have investigated the potential health benefits of CLA; these findings indicate that CLA might influence body composition, weight management, and overall health in a positive way. Notably, although some evidence supports these prospective benefits, the research is inconclusive; further investigations are required to comprehensively comprehend the mechanisms and enduring consequences of CLA supplementation. Book excerpt: Research for this thesis consisted of three parts; determining CLA effects on 1) whole animal body composition in aged mice, 2) whole animal body composition parameters in a murine model of cachexia, 3) specific muscles, adipose depots, and organs as well as the effects on parameters of muscle degradation in aged mice. The first study indicates CLA decreased fat mass and increased whole animal protein mass in aged mice. In the second study, infection resulted in changes in carcass water, fat, and protein. CLA caused an increase in protein mass in the controls but was unable to increase protein mass in cachectic animals. In the third study, no changes in muscle weights were observed with CLA and there was no effect on parameters of muscle degradation. These results demonstrate the complex nature of CLA and the need for further investigation.

This book was released on 2007 with total page p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: "Conjugated linoleic acid (CLA) reduces body weight and fat mass in animals. Human trials investigating effects of CLA on blood lipids, body weight and composition have shown inconsistent effects. The purpose of the present study therefore was to investigate effects of milk enriched with CLA on blood lipids -triglyceride (TG), total cholesterol (TC), low-density lipoprotein (LDL), high- density lipoprotein (HDL) cholesterol, body weight and body composition in moderately overweight, hyperlipidemic humans. Fifteen adult participants completed three 8-week dietary treatments in a crossover design. Treatments were: (i) control milk low in cis-9, trans-11 CLA (ii) milk naturally enriched with cis-9, trans-11 CLA, (iii) milk synthetically enriched with trans-10, cis-12 CLA and cis-9, trans-11 CLA. CLA did not affect blood lipid profile. No significant changes were observed in body weights and fat compartments with the CLA isomers. Thus CLA does not affect lipid profile, body weight and composition in moderately hyperlipidemic individuals." --

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: "Overweight and obesity are the most widespread nutritional diseases in the U.S., which greatly increase chronic disease risks and mortality. Therefore, it is urgent to develop a relatively efficacious and safe strategy for the weight management. Consumption of conjugated linoleic acid (CLA) supplements or one of its isomers, trans-10, cis-12 (10,12) CLA, has consistently demonstrated reductions in body weight or body fat in human and animal studies. Our lab has demonstrated that 10,12 CLA triggered calcium release from endoplasmic reticulum in human primary adipocytes, which activated downstream inflammatory signaling, resulting in impaired uptake of glucose and fatty acid, and delipidation. However, the upstream signals responsible for these actions are unknown. Therefore, my Aim 1 investigated the upstream mechanism by which 10,12 CLA increases intracellular calcium and inflammatory signaling in human primary adipocytes. The results indicated that phospholipase C plays an important role in 10,12 CLA-mediated activation of intracellular calcium accumulation, inflammatory signaling, delipidation, and insulin resistance in human primary adipocytes. It has been demonstrated that 10,12 CLA increased mRNA levels and protein levels of cyclooxygenase-2 (COX-2) and pro-inflammatory prostaglandins, which have been linked to increased energy expenditure associated with white adipose tissue (WAT) browning and uncoupling of ATP synthesis. It also has been shown that relatively high doses of 10,12 CLA lead to more significant reductions in body fat, but cause a greater level of inflammation, insulin resistance, and steatosis in animals. Therefore, Aims 2 and Aim 3 determined the extent to which a relative low dose of 10,12 CLA or a CLA isomer mixture increases markers of browning in mice and its dependence in inflammatory signaling. In Aim 2, a low threshold dose of 10,12 CLA was found that prevented body fat accumulation with minimum metabolic side-effects in non-obese mice. It was also found that 10,12 CLA-induced browning in WAT was accompanied by increases in mRNA levels of COX-2 and other markers of inflammation. In Aim 3, a relatively low dose of 10,12 CLA reduced body fat and increased browning of WAT in overweight mice, which were independent of inflammatory signaling. Collectively, these findings provide critical insights for the development of reliable dietary strategies for people who take CLA as method to lose weight. However, we still do not know (i) if 10,12 CLA supplementation would effectively reduce body fat in overweight mice when they are continuously fed an American-type, high-fat diet; (ii) potential risks of impaired regulation of body temperature, inflammation, and steatosis due to 10,12 CLA consumption in high fat-fed mice; and (iii) potential mechanisms by which 10,12 CLA reduces body fat in high fat-fed mice."--Abstract from author supplied metadata.

Book excerpt: Conjugated linoleic acids (CLA) isomers of linoleic acid – a compound derived from meat and dairy products. Attention was first drawn to their potential anti-carcinogen properties in the 1980’s; since then further health benefits have been reported, and applications in the glue and paint industries as a renewable resource have been explored. This comprehensive book presents an overview of the background and research into CLA and examines each of their applications in the context of the chemistry surrounding them and CLA-enriched oils. The biosynthesis of CLA is presented, with a discussion on how animal husbandry could promote CLA production. Other chapters examine the current strategies for their synthesis using bespoke catalysts and enzymes. Book excerpt: "The overall objective of this thesis was to investigate differences between the FFA and TG forms of CLA regarding incorporation in liver and biological musculoskeletal responses; if assessment of PTH is affected by gender, fasting and the type of PTH assay used; if CLA status, as measured by red blood cell CLA content, in men is positively related to body composition and bone mass; if CLA supplementation in healthy men reduces PTH concentration; and if CLA can prevent decreases in bone and muscle mass typically observed in advanced aging. Methods: Study 1: Sprague-Dawley rats were randomized at weaning to receive a control AIN-93 diet or the same diet supplemented with 0.5% c9, t11 CLA + 0.5% t10, c12 CLA in FFA or TG form. Liver fatty acid profiles were assessed using gas chromatography. Biomarkers of bone metabolism were measured along with bone density and body composition using dual-energy x-ray absorptiometry (DXA) after 4, 8, 16 wk. Study 2: Sprague-Dawley rats were randomized at weaning to receive a control AIN-93 diet or the same diet supplemented with 0.5% c9, t11 CLA + 0.5% t10, c12 CLA in FFA for 16 wk. At wk 16, a blood sample was collected in both a fed state and a non-fed state. PTH was assessed using both a second and third generation PTH assays. Study 3: Healthy men 19-53 y (n=31) were randomized in a double-blind, placebo controlled clinical dose-response trial to receive either: 1.5 g/d or 3.0 g/d of c9, t11 CLA (4:1 c9, t11 to t10, c12 isomer ratio) or placebo (olive oil 3 g/d) for 16 wk. DXA was performed to assess body composition at baseline and end of study and blood samples were obtained monthly to evaluate changes in PTH concentration, 25-hydroxy vitamin D (25(OH)D), iCa, phosphate and lipid profile. Study 4: As an advanced aging model, pigmented guinea pigs (n=40) were block randomized by weight at 70 wk of age to 4 groups: 1) SHAM+Control diet, 2) SHAM+ CLA diet (1.0% 4:1 c9, t11 to t10, c12 isomer ratio), 3) Orchidectomy (ORX)+Control diet, 4) ORX+CLA diet. DXA scans for bone density and body composition in addition to blood samples to measure testosterone, estrogen, interleukin-6 (IL-6), were performed at baseline and wk 16. At 16 wk, iCa and 25(OH)D were assessed as well as, bone microarchitecture using micro computed tomography, bone strength and acute protein fractional synthesis rate in skeletal muscle using a flooding dose of 40 mol% of L-[ring-2H5]-phenylalanine (1.5 mmol/kg ip). Results: Study 1: There were no differences among groups for growth, bone biomarkers or mass nor mineral balance. Liver enrichment of c9, t11 CLA in FFA form was greater than TG form and AIN-93. Study 2: Females had a lower iCa compared to males. In males and females, there was no difference between fed and non-fed groups when PTH was assessed using the INT PTH assay. However, in females only, PTH measured using the BIO PTH was significantly lower in the fed group versus the non-fed. Study 3: Men with red blood cell (RBC) c9, t11 CLA status above the median had higher whole body bone mineral density (BMD) and whole body lean mass % (WBL), whereas body mass index (BMI) and whole body fat mass % (WBF) were lower. In regression analysis, RBC c9, t11 CLA status accounted for a significant proportion (r2=0.10) of the variation in whole body BMD (P=0.03). There were no time or treatment differences among any bone or biomarkers of bone metabolism including PTH. Study 4: CLA prevented an increase in Tb.Sp and a decrease in vBMD in metaphyseal regions of ORX compared to SHAM CTRL. CLA also decreased porosity in ORX compared to SHAM. ORX decreased free testosterone whereas interleukin-6 increased. CLA prevented ORX-induced loss of metaphyseal vBMD and bone volume as well as enhanced diaphyseal porosity. Also, no differences in quadriceps mixed muscle sarcoplasmic and myofibrillar protein fractional synthesis rate were detected. Significance: Overall, small benefits of CLA on the musculoskeletal system were observed." --
